Top definition
When your finger gets smashed by an extremely huge and heavy object and the result is an extra inch of finger ( unfortunately after a trip to the ER). It is then in turn quite the lady pleaser!!
Justin: "Dude your finger looks like a dildo ever since u got it smashed"

Aaron: "Yeah isn't it awesome! The girlfriend loves that extra inch."

Justin: " I think im going to smash my finger so I can have a McCildo."

Aaron: " Yeah u should! Trust me she won't be disapointed."
by thebreeze April 08, 2008
Mug icon

The Urban Dictionary Mug

One side has the word, one side has the definition. Microwave and dishwasher safe. Lotsa space for your liquids.

Buy the mug